About This Ohio Facility

Central Clinic - Middletown is a reputable drug treatment facility located in Middletown, Ohio. It is accredited by CARF (Commission on Accreditation of Rehabilitation Facilities), which ensures the facility meets high standards of quality and provides effective treatment for addiction and substance abuse. Central Clinic - Middletown specializes in treating individuals suffering from alcoholism, opioid addiction, dual diagnosis, and drug addiction. They offer various levels of care, including drug rehab and outpatient programs, to cater to the specific needs and preferences of each patient. The facility accepts private health insurance, making it accessible to a broader range of individuals seeking treatment. Central Clinic - Middletown is affiliated with Central Clinic, a well-established organization dedicated to providing comprehensive and compassionate care to individuals struggling with addiction.

    Nicotine replacement therapy (NRT) is a treatment that helps people to quit smoking. In nicotine replacement therapy, a controlled amount of nicotine is provided in the form of gums, patches, or sprays. They do not contain the harmful chemicals usually found in tobacco products. NRT reduces the withdrawal symptoms by giving nicotine in low doses. However, NRT provides relief only from the physical withdrawal symptoms. The emotional and psychological aspects of quitting needs to be treated separately. While NRT is safe for most adults, teens and pregnant women should not undergo NRT. Research shows that the use of NRT doubles the chances of quitting smoking.

    Middletown, Ohio Addiction Information

    Ohio is suffering from a drug abuse problem that is costing thousands of its residents their lives every single year. Opioids, particularly Fentanyl and heroin, are the leading drugs in the state. The state ranks in the top 10 for illicit use of painkillers. Opioid-related overdose rates in Ohio are by far some of the highest in the country.

    The drug addiction problem in Middletown, OH, is relatively bad. In 2010, there was a total of 376 drug-related overdose deaths in the area. Of these overdoses, 232 (61%) involved at least one prescription opioid. In 2017, there was a 29% increase among people seeking treatment for addiction to alcohol.
